Mark Grossd82b3512008-02-04 22:30:08 -08001/*
2 * This module exposes the interface to kernel space for specifying
3 * QoS dependencies. It provides infrastructure for registration of:
4 *
Mark Grossed771342010-05-06 01:59:26 +02005 * Dependents on a QoS value : register requests
Mark Grossd82b3512008-02-04 22:30:08 -08006 * Watchers of QoS value : get notified when target QoS value changes
7 *
8 * This QoS design is best effort based. Dependents register their QoS needs.
9 * Watchers register to keep track of the current QoS needs of the system.
10 *
11 * There are 3 basic classes of QoS parameter: latency, timeout, throughput
12 * each have defined units:
13 * latency: usec
14 * timeout: usec <-- currently not used.
15 * throughput: kbs (kilo byte / sec)
16 *
Mark Grossed771342010-05-06 01:59:26 +020017 * There are lists of pm_qos_objects each one wrapping requests, notifiers
Mark Grossd82b3512008-02-04 22:30:08 -080018 *
Mark Grossed771342010-05-06 01:59:26 +020019 * User mode requests on a QOS parameter register themselves to the
Mark Grossd82b3512008-02-04 22:30:08 -080020 * subsystem by opening the device node /dev/... and writing there request to
21 * the node. As long as the process holds a file handle open to the node the
22 * client continues to be accounted for. Upon file release the usermode
Mark Grossed771342010-05-06 01:59:26 +020023 * request is removed and a new qos target is computed. This way when the
24 * request that the application has is cleaned up when closes the file
Mark Grossd82b3512008-02-04 22:30:08 -080025 * pointer or exits the pm_qos_object will get an opportunity to clean up.
26 *
Richard Hughesbf1db692008-08-05 13:01:35 -070027 * Mark Gross <mgross@linux.intel.com>
Mark Grossd82b3512008-02-04 22:30:08 -080028 */
